When selecting the best cold packs for juice shipping, it’s important to consider factors beyond just price. The right pack should maintain the ideal temperature without freezing the juice, prevent leaks, and fit well into your packaging. Durability and reusability can also save costs over time, especially if you’re shipping frequently. Understanding these considerations helps you choose cold packs that align with your specific shipping needs and budget.Cooling Duration and Temperature Control
Assess how long the cold pack can maintain the desired temperature. For longer shipping times, look for packs with 24+ hour freeze power. Some gel packs and dry ice options excel here, but they may come at a higher cost. Shorter durations might be sufficient for local deliveries, allowing you to opt for more affordable options. Understand how the pack performs in real-world conditions, especially in warm climates or with insulated boxes.
Food Safety and Material Composition
Shipping juice requires packs that are food-safe and BPA-free to prevent contamination. Many gel packs are made with non-toxic, food-grade materials, which is crucial for maintaining product safety. Avoid packs with questionable chemicals or leaks, as these can spoil the juice or pose health risks. Also, consider whether the cold pack is reusable, which can offer better value over time without compromising safety.
Flexibility and Fit
Cold packs come in various shapes and sizes—sheets, bricks, gel packs. The best choice depends on your packaging design. Flexible, sheet-style packs can mold around irregular shapes or fit snugly into tight spaces, maximizing cooling efficiency. Rigid gel packs may be easier to handle but can limit placement options. Consider your package dimensions carefully to avoid waste or gaps in insulation.
Cost and Bulk Value
Bulk purchasing often reduces per-unit costs, making it ideal for frequent shippers. However, larger packs or bulk packs can be bulkier and heavier, impacting shipping costs. Balance your budget with performance needs—sometimes paying a bit more upfront for longer-lasting packs reduces the risk of spoilage and returns. Think about how often you ship and whether reusability justifies the initial investment.
Ease of Use and Maintenance
Look for cold packs that are easy to freeze, handle, and reuse. Packs that leak or break easily can cause messes and waste. Reusable packs with durable shells and non-stick surfaces tend to last longer and require less maintenance. Additionally, consider whether the packs require special storage conditions before use, as this can add to your operational complexity.
Frequently Asked Questions
How long do cold packs typically last during shipping?
The duration varies depending on the type and quality of the cold pack. Gel packs and dry ice options can last anywhere from 12 to over 48 hours under optimal conditions. For juice shipping, it’s best to select packs rated for at least 24 hours if your transit time exceeds a day. Always test your chosen packs in real shipping conditions to ensure they maintain the desired temperature throughout the journey.
Are gel packs safe for shipping juice?
Yes, most gel packs designed for food shipping are made with food-safe, non-toxic materials. Look for products explicitly labeled BPA-free and food-grade to ensure they won’t contaminate your juice. Avoid using non-certified packs that may contain harmful chemicals or leaks, as these could compromise product safety and customer trust.
Can I reuse cold packs for multiple shipments?
Many gel and dry ice packs are reusable if handled properly. Reusability depends on the material quality and whether the pack shows signs of damage or leaks. Reusing packs can save costs over time, but always inspect them thoroughly before reuse to prevent spoilage or leaks that could damage your products or packaging.
What size or shape of cold pack is best for small juice bottles?
Flexible sheet packs or small gel bricks tend to work well for small bottles, allowing you to maximize contact and cooling efficiency without taking up too much space. For irregularly shaped bottles, consider packs that can mold around the product or be cut to fit. Proper sizing helps maintain a consistent cold temperature and prevents unnecessary waste.
Is dry ice a better option than gel packs for juice shipping?
Dry ice offers longer-lasting cooling, often exceeding 24 hours, making it suitable for extended shipments. However, it requires special handling due to its sublimation and potential safety hazards. Gel packs are safer and easier to handle but may not last as long. The choice depends on your shipping duration, safety considerations, and budget.
